#373171 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#373171 is composed of 21.6% red, 19.2%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.3% cyan, 56.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 245.6 degrees, a saturation of 39.5% and a lightness of 31.8%. #373171 color hex could be obtained by blending #6e62e2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#373171

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020204 is the darkest color, while #f5f5fb is the lightest one.
